  • @oneweirdfellah yes, lots of people assume its a Torino - understandable, since when they were designing the Aussie coupe they initially looked at, then rejected, Torino bodies and ended up designing their own. Having said that, there is some similarity particularly around the shape of the side windows but the Aussie car is a unique design - there are no similar parts (although I'm pretty sure they DO share the same front bumper as a 71 Mustang..)
